In the fast-paced world of footwear manufacturing, sport shoe making machines have emerged as vital assets for companies aiming to streamline their production processes while maintaining high standards of quality. These machines are designed to facilitate various stages of shoe production, from cutting materials to assembling components, ultimately fostering greater efficiency and consistency in the final product.
One of the primary advantages of using sport shoe making machines is their ability to automate repetitive tasks, which significantly reduces the time required for production. For instance, advanced cutting machines can precisely cut various materials, such as leather, textiles, and synthetic fabrics, ensuring accurate shapes and sizes. This precision not only enhances the quality of the shoes but also minimizes material wastage, a critical factor in today’s environmentally-conscious market.
Moreover, sport shoe making machines often incorporate advanced technology such as computer numerical control (CNC) and robotics. These technologies enable manufacturers to execute complex designs and patterns that would be challenging to achieve manually. As a result, companies can offer a broader range of customizable options to their customers, catering to diverse preferences and styles.
In addition to automation, sport shoe making machines can improve the overall efficiency of the production line. By synchronizing various manufacturing processes, such as stitching and assembling, these machines help to create a seamless workflow. This interconnectedness not only speeds up production but also ensures that quality control measures are consistently applied, leading to fewer defects in the final products.
Another significant aspect of sport shoe making machines is their adaptability. As consumer trends evolve, manufacturers must be agile in responding to market demands. Modern sport shoe making machines are designed to be versatile, allowing companies to switch between different shoe models and styles with minimal downtime. This flexibility is crucial for brands that wish to stay competitive in a rapidly changing industry.
Furthermore, investing in sport shoe making machines can lead to long-term cost savings. While the initial investment may be substantial, the reduction in labor costs, material waste, and production time can result in considerable financial benefits. Over time, the efficiency gained through automation can enhance the overall profitability of a manufacturing operation.
In conclusion, sport shoe making machines are revolutionizing the footwear manufacturing landscape by offering enhanced efficiency, precision, and adaptability. As the demand for high-quality athletic footwear continues to rise, these machines are becoming indispensable tools for manufacturers looking to thrive in a competitive environment. By embracing the technological advancements offered by sport shoe making machines, companies can not only improve their production processes but also elevate their brand's reputation in the marketplace.
